The program of the symposium “Yaşar Kemal and a Thousand and One Flowers in the Garden” to be organized by İzmir Metropolitan Municipality and Yaşar Kemal Foundation on 2-3 December has been announced. Many academicians, journalists, artists and literary figures will attend the symposium as speakers.

Preparations for the “A Thousand and One Flowers in the Garden with Yaşar Kemal” symposium in İzmir continue at full speed. The program of the symposium on “Nature, Environment and Ecological Reality in Yaşar Kemal's Narrative World” organized by İzmir Metropolitan Municipality and Yaşar Kemal Foundation has been announced. The symposium to be held on 2-3 December at İzmir Ahmed Adnan Saygun Art Center (AASSM) will host friends of many academics, journalists, artists, men of letters and master writers.

Coordinated by writer and critic Feridun Andaç, the symposium will focus on the "nature" and "human" elements in Yaşar Kemal's narrative world. Speakers will evaluate Yaşar Kemal's literature from aspects such as social memory, social conscience and a pioneering understanding of nature in a preliminary and 6 thematic sessions.

In the preliminary session, Yaşar Kemal will be told by his friends

The two-day symposium will start on December 2 with the “Hello to Yaşar Kemal” preliminary session. Türkan Şoray, the director of the film, which was adapted from Yaşar Kemal's novel "The Snake Kills" with the same name to the big screen, American composer Michael Ellison, who adapted the master author's novel "Deniz Küstü" into a musical theater play, Lucien, the manager of Union Publishing, which publishes the books of the master author in Switzerland. Leitess and poet Ataol Behramoğlu will attend as speakers. His close friends will talk about both Yaşar Kemal and his literature.
After the symposium, Kardes Turkuler will give a concert.

“The end of the corruption of nature is the corruption of mankind”

Master writer Yaşar Kemal describes the point of the relationship between man and nature as follows: “The end of the corruption of nature is the corruption of human beings. Can we predict in advance what the corrupt, depraved, rotten humanity will do and not do? Can humanity overcome its madness and recreate nature and return to its own creativity? Shall we start crying to the end already? Or should we put our heads in our hands and join forces to save nature, to this madness?"
